Vancouver-headquartered Sierra Systems Group Inc. has acquired Calgary's RIS Inc., a provider of applications support and maintenance services.
Founded in 1979, RIS employs more than 250 staff and 350 subcontractors. Its acquisition will expand Sierra's presence primarily in Calgary and Toronto, but also in Regina, Edmonton and in the U.S. and Bucharest, Romania, where RIS has an office.
Golden Gate Capital, which bought Sierra Systems earlier this year, said the deal will help expand both companies, which share similar corporate cultures and track records and have complementary services.
Effective January 1, 2008, RIS will operate under the Sierra Systems brand.
